About Mark Smith
Mark has been thinking and writing about games since a Gameboy Pocket and a copy of Link's Awakening was first placed into his tender, seven-year-old hands.
Since then, he snagged a creative writing (BA) degree, roleplayed as a banker, an English teacher, and finally, a games writer – all while pursuing his true passion: inhabiting and creating virtual worlds.
As well as writing about, reading about, thinking about, talking about, dreaming about, and generally fantasizing about video games, Mark also dabbles with game development.
